Yorkville Car Show

This Saturday (July 10th, 2010) over 60 exotic Porsche and Ferraris will be on display in support of the Sick Kids Foundation!  From 11:30 a.m. to 5:30 p.m. Yorkville Avenue, Bellair Street & Cumberland Street will be closed to traffic between Old York Lane and Bellair Street for the entire day to make way for the Yorkville Exotic Car Show.

Take a walk through Yorkville any day of the week and you’re bound to see some of the finest cars in the City along the avenues!  But for this event some of the most highly coveted vehicles, including the Ferrari Enzo, 2009 Ferrari 16M, 1956 Porsche 356 Speedster, 1964 Porsche 356 SC Coupe, a Carrera GT and the 1996 Porsche GT1, one of only three in Canada and 17 in the world will be in Yorkville for onlookers to see!

Back in January we covered the launch of the Nicholas Residences. Originally the tower was calling for 29 stories, but now they’ve released another 6 floors bringing it to a total of 35!  If you missed your chance to purchase earlier in the year, now is a perfect time to choose between a limited selection of 1 and 2 bedroom suites.  Only 54 units are being made available in this final release at Nicholas Residences.

The building will feature architectural design by CORE Architects and interiors complemented by Cecconi Simone. Residents will be surrounded by floor to ceiling windows and either a Balcony, French Balcony or Terrace. The 9 foot ceilings will be capped with a smooth finish. Owners can select between pre-engineered wood flooring or German engineered high performance wide plank laminate flooring.  Parking is available for almost every suite!

On Thursday June 3rd, 2010 the monthly art walk will be making it’s rounds through the various Yorkville galleries!  It’s a great opportunity to find that special piece for your Yorkville condo!  The walk will take guests to seven galleries including:

1. Hollander York Gallery
2. Ingram Gallery
3. Kinsman Robinson Galleries
4. Lane Gallery
5. Leonardo Galleries
6. Liss Gallery
7. Odon Wagner Gallery

According to the Yorkville Art Walk website:  The informal, free tour begins by gathering at the Rotunda (lower level) in the Hazelton Lanes Mall, opposite Browns’ Shoe Store. The attendees split into two or three smaller groups which visit selected area galleries during the evening. Each small group is led by a tour guide who is familiar with art appreciation and the local art scene. Some of the galleries may have featured artists present for the tour. A wide range of Contemporary or Historical Canadian and International works of art are available for viewing. At the end of the evening attendees may join the group for coffee at a local area café.

Hungry but don’t feel like cooking? Forgot to pack a lunch? Or maybe you missed your daily fix of Starbucks. Whatever the case, the new Market by Longo’s could probably solve all those problems!

BloorCondos visited the new store to see what fresh finds The Market offered. The store isn’t large by traditional standards, but that’s not necessarily a bad thing. The compact sized store made it easy to navigate with tons of friendly staff nearby to help. The salad bar seemed to be the most popular attraction, where many people were mixing and matching salad combos. Past the salad bar was a sushi station with sets made right in front of you! Some delicious entrées can be had along the west wall with everything from a bakery to a pizza parlour. There’s a fresh fish counter at the back with prepared meats seasoned and ready to go… and for those who like their coffee on the run; the built-in Starbucks is there to serve you!

The Market is a great addition to Bloor and Yonge, giving residents and employees of the neighbourhood a great selection of prepared foods at a convenient location. The Market is located next to the Toronto Marriot – Bloor Yorkville at Bloor and Park Rd (100 Bloor Street East Toronto ON M4W 1A7) and open from Monday – Friday 7am-9pm Saturday & Sunday 7am-8pm!
